Core Research Domain: Mastering the Science of Sensory Relief
The beating heart of Rohto-Mentholatum's innovation lies in its profound expertise in sensory relief formulations. This is far more than just adding menthol to a product; it is a sophisticated science of balancing intensity, duration, and perception to create a therapeutic experience. The company's deep R&D investment focuses on understanding the mechanisms of thermoreceptors in the skin and mucous membranes, and how compounds like menthol, camphor, and capsicum can safely and effectively modulate these signals. For Rohto-Mentholatum, the cooling sensation of their iconic eye drops or the warming feel of a pain relief patch is not a superficial marketing gimmick—it is the primary active communication of the product working. This sensory signature serves a dual purpose: it provides immediate, perceptible feedback that something is happening, which alleviates psychological distress, while the underlying pharmaceutical agents address the root cause of irritation or pain. This mastery over formulating precise sensory profiles is the cornerstone of their brand identity. It creates a powerful, non-verbal promise: a product from Rohto-Mentholatum will deliver a specific, recognizable, and effective feeling of relief, setting them apart in markets crowded with sensationless alternatives.
Portfolio Diversification through Strategic Technology Transfer
A key to Rohto-Mentholatum's expansive portfolio is its strategic application of core technologies across seemingly disparate health categories. This is not random diversification but a calculated process of technology transfer. The foundational expertise in creating stable, safe, and controllable menthol-based delivery systems, honed in their ophthalmic solutions under the Rohto line, became a springboard for innovation elsewhere. The same scientific principles that govern the release of a cooling agent onto the delicate ocular surface were adapted and refined for other applications. For instance, the technology behind achieving a prolonged, gentle cooling effect was transferred to lip care products, providing relief for dry, chapped lips. More significantly, it was leveraged to develop the renowned Mentholatum pain relief patches and gels. Here, the challenge was to transfer the sensory relief technology to a transdermal format, ensuring the cooling or warming sensation penetrated muscle tissue for therapeutic effect while maintaining skin safety. This cross-category application demonstrates a brilliant R&D strategy: a deep investment in one core competency (sensory delivery systems) that can be repurposed to solve problems in eye care, dermatology, musculoskeletal health, and respiratory relief. Every new product under the Rohto-Mentholatum umbrella reinforces and is reinforced by this central technological pillar.
Market-Driven Innovation: Responding to Evolving Consumer Needs
The R&D engine at Rohto-Mentholatum is powerfully fueled by keen market observation and a proactive response to emerging consumer health trends. Their product launches often serve as textbook examples of innovation that meets a newly articulated or growing need. A prime case is the development of specialized eye drops targeting digital eye strain. As screen time skyrocketed globally, consumers reported symptoms like dryness and fatigue. Rohto-Mentholatum R&D responded not just with a moisturizing formula, but with products that offered the brand's signature intense cooling sensation, which users associated with revitalization and relief from screen-induced stress. This directly addressed the desire for a perceptible "reset" for overworked eyes. Similarly, in the topical analgesic space, the market demanded faster-acting solutions for active lifestyles. This led to innovations in gel and spray formulations that combined rapid-evaporation technology with their sensory actives, creating a "fast-cooling" or "deep-heating" effect that users could feel working within seconds, aligning with the need for immediate intervention after physical activity. These examples show that Rohto-Mentholatum does not innovate in a vacuum. Their R&D process integrates consumer insights, allowing them to apply their sensory relief expertise to contemporary problems, ensuring their products remain relevant and sought-after.
